Human Papillomavirus Positivity and Frequency of Genotypes in Servical Samples of Women Living in Sivas Region

Objective: Our aim in this study, is to determine the frequency of human papilloma virus DNA and its genotypes, and to evaluate the association between servical smear and results.

Materials and Methods: Our study was realised with 140 women who is between 21 and 67 years. HPV DNA was researched with PCR method in servical smears of patients and HPV genotyping was carried out with reverse hybridization procedure in HybriMax (Hybribio). Then, smears taken with servical brush were spreaded on slides and they were sent to pathology department for examining.

Results: In our study, % 6,4 of case have HPV positiveness. In our study, the most frequent genotype of HPV is HPV type 6 (%25). The second is HPV 16 (%16,6). The ratio for pathologic negativity and HPV positiveness is %77,8. It were detected that %94,7 of the patients with smear negative are HPV negative and %5,3 of them are HPV positive. %33,3 of the patients with condylomata accuminata are HPV negative, %66,7 of them are HPV positive. Patient diagnosed as VIN is only one and detected HPV negativity.

Conclusion: The degree of HPV DNA positivity which we detected in our region is high. In addition to cytologic evaluation, molecular techniques are also important for following the disease. Molecular works will be useful to determine the priority of genotypes that will be use for routine vaccination in our country, in future.
